Method 1: Guide To Start OS into 'Safe Mode with Networking' to Get Rid Of F1220@tuta.io Ransomware

Experts say that Safe Mode with Networking is a useful feature that facilitates OS users to Delete viruses and malware such as F1220@tuta.io Ransomware from affected PC safely. Hence, we suggest you to restart your OS in Safe Mode with Networking before proceeding manual removal procedures.

Guide To Turn on OS Running Win XP/Vista/7 into Safe Mode with Networking

  • Go to Start and click Restart from Power option and during restarting process you need to keep tapping F8 button simultaneously.
  • Now, Advanced Boot Option can be seen on your OS screen. Next, you should use UP/DOWN arrow key to select Safe Mode with Networking and tap Enter button on your keyboard to restart your OS in Safe Mode with Networking.

Guide To Turn on OS Running Win 8.1/10 into Safe Mode with Networking

  • First you need to go to Start and then hold the Shift button and choose Restart from Power menu.
  • Afterwards, you have to choose Troubleshoot option and then click Advanced options immediately.
  • Next, Click Startup Settings option and click Restart button located at bottom-left.
  • When your OS restarts, press 5 key on your keyboard to turn on your Win 8.1/10 into Safe Mode with Networking.
